The Isolating Driver D5020 module is a high integrity analog output interface suitable for applications requiring SIL 2 level in safety related systems for high risk industries. It isolates and transfers a 4- 20 mA signal from a controller located in Safe Area to a load in Hazardous Area. It has a high output capacity combined with a low drop across its input terminals. The circuit allows bi-directional communication signals, for HART® smart positioners. Line and load open/short circuit detection is provided: the fault in the field is directly mirrored to the PLC AO and it is also reported by opening the fault output.
24 Vdc nom (18 to 30 Vdc), reverse polarity protected
Current Consumption
70 mA @ 24 Vdc with 20 mA output on 500 Ω load, typical.
Power Dissipation
1.3 W @ 24 Vdc with 20 mA output on 500 Ω load, typical.
Input
Type
4 to 20 mA with ≤ 2.5 V voltage drop, reverse polarity protected in normal operation, ≥ 5 kΩ impedance (≈ 2 mA sinking from 10 to 30 Vdc) when fault condition detected.
Output
Type
4 to 20 mA, on max. 700 Ω load.
Response time
25 ms (0 to 100 % step change).
Fault
Type
Field device and wiring open circuit or short circuit detection; short circuit detection can be disabled via dip-switch.
Short output
load resistance < 50 Ω or < 100 Ω dip-switch selectable (≈ 2 mA forcing to detect fault).
Open output
load resistance > (21 V / Loop current) -300 Ω (for example, if Loop current = 20 mA: load resistance > (21 V / 20 mA) -300 Ω = 750 Ω).
Fault signaling
voltage free NE SPST optocoupled open-collector transistor (output de-energized in fault condition).
Open-collector/drain rating
100 mA @ 35 Vdc (≤ 1.5 V voltage drop).
Leakage current
≤ 50 μA @ 35 Vdc.
Response time
≤ 30 ms.
Performance
Ref. Conditions
24 V supply, 250 Ω load, 23 ± 1 °C ambient temperature.
